we've been through this and there are a few threads about this already(i am sure the 1st and 2nd gen has threads as well). but it doesn't stand for anything. we've come up with all sorts of acronyms but if it did stand for something then so would tsx, rsx, mdx, rl, nsx and soon to be rdx. what possibly can those vehicles with the "x" in them stand for. so here is my explanation from what i have read in some publication. acura uses these naming conventions strictly for North America to set the class status of a vehicle. traditionally a higher number indicates a more expensive car like in bmw's case. and mercedes uses alpha-numeric combinations to indicate the class of the car. i personally think acura is trying to adopt the same approach in its attempt to market it's cars here. But because acura does not offer different engine options for each of its cars it does not have a mixture of alpha-numerics and just alphas. we all know that the same cars acura offers here, in japan all have names associated to them. however americans in general when buying a luxury car are not comfortable with a regular name associated to it. besides the s2000 all other hondas sold here have a regular name given to the car. but to compete with the european luxury brands who strictly use this alpha-numeric nomenclature for their cars honda has to use this for their acura line up here.
